I had a disappointing experience with this pizza store, and unfortunately, it seems to stem from poor management and a lack of discipline in how the business is run. When I called to place an order, I asked if they accepted phone orders. The person on the phone confirmed they did, so I went ahead and ordered a chicken pizza. She told me it would be ready in 15 minutes, but her tone was so indifferent and unprofessional that it felt like she didn’t care about her job at all.

After 15 minutes, I arrived at the store. The receptionist tried to locate my order but couldn’t find it. To my surprise, he then asked me to pay so they could start making the pizza! This showed a complete lack of coordination and organization. I ended up paying and waiting another 15 minutes for them to prepare it.

The pizza itself was another letdown. The chicken tasted stale, as if it had been sitting for days, and it had an unpleasant smell. It seemed like they just threw on scraps of chicken from the counter rather than using fresh, quality ingredients. The bread was tough, dry, and hard to chew, making the meal even less enjoyable.

Overall, this experience reflects poorly on the store's owner or management. It’s clear they haven’t properly trained their staff or implemented the discipline needed to run a business efficiently. Poor training and a lack of organization are the reasons customers like me have such an unpleasant experience. I would rate them 1 star and definitely wouldn’t recommend this...

Came here on a Saturday night with friends and I must say this is a very good place for wood fire pizza.

For appetizers we went with jalapeƱo corn bread which had the jalapeƱo flavor with corn and… bread. It comes with a slightly sweet honey butter which made it a sweet treat.

Next we got the Burrata + Tomatoes with Pesto which was a very refreshing treat. I’m a big fan of the pesto here and the burrata on the toast made it a nice appetizer.

For pizzas we went with margherita which was solid, just slightly wet. The sauce went all over the plate but it’s a nice subtle melody of tomato pizza with basil.

Next we got the salsiccia which was a nice savory pizza with chives and fennel seeds. We added pesto too and made for a very nice hearty pizza.

Lastly we got the calabrese + honey. I don’t really taste the honey except for on the crust so for me it wasn’t that salt and sweet pizza I was hoping to be. It was just another ham pizza at the end of the day.

For drinks, I ordered the nectar on the rise which I absolutely love. Very nice tequila with ginger beer cocktail. My friend ordered peacock daisy which didn’t have a lasting taste. It felt flat and not great.

Service isn’t too bad. We had to keep asking for water when our jar was empty. We also had to wait forever for our waiter to come get the check.

Overall, our next door table was super noisy, super belligerent because they were so inebriated. But overall without them, this place would be a...

Rise Woodfire is one of those rare finds that nails both style and substance. We came on a Sunday afternoon around 2:30, and enjoyed the comforting smell of wood-fired everything in the air. The space is surprisingly large, with a chill, breezy vibe outside and a sleek, modern feel inside. High ceilings, open kitchen, bustling bar—you can actually see the wood-fired ovens in action, which adds so much to the experience. It’s the kind of place where you instantly relax but still feel like you’re somewhere special. We started with the creamy, garlicky hummus and warm pita, followed by bubbling hot mac and cheese, a crisp Margherita pizza, and a perfectly medium-rare side of ribeye. The salmon (ordered clean with no oil) was light, flaky, and beautifully done. The salad brought freshness and crunch, rounding everything out. Dessert looked incredible—most are wood-fired and come warm with a scoop of ice cream—but we were too full (next time, it’s happening). Bonus points for the full bar and a rare find: Green Chartreuse. This is a spot I’ll be recommending again and again—for the food, the vibe, and the way it all just works. Shoutout to Rocio who was so attentive and kind and just was so patient with my picky order.
